emission


emis·sion

noun \ē-ˈmish-ən\

Definition of EMISSION

1
: an act or instance of emitting
2
a : something sent forth by emitting: as (1) : electrons discharged from a surface (2) : electromagnetic waves radiated by an antenna or a celestial body (3) : substances and especially pollutants discharged into the air (as by a smokestack or an automobile gasoline engine) b : a discharge of fluid from a living body; especially : ejaculate—see nocturnal emission
